Principal
/
Otras Aplicaciones
/
¿Cómo copiar o mover tu sitio web Magento a una nueva ubicación?

¿Cómo copiar o mover tu sitio web Magento a una nueva ubicación?

Crear la nueva carpeta (si no existe)

El primer paso de mover o copiar tu sitio web a una nueva ubicación es crear el nuevo directorio. Puedes hacerlo mediante el Gestor de archivos o a través de tu cliente FTP preferido. Puedes encontrar más información sobre cómo usar FTP, en nuestro tutorial FTP.

Crear una copia de los archivos 

Una vez creada la carpeta de destino, copia los archivos del sitio web. Una vez más, puede hacerlo a través de la herramienta Gestor de archivos o a través del cliente FTP. Debes copiar todos los archivos del directorio raíz del sitio web Magento a la carpeta de destino. Asegúrate de no olvidar el archivo .htaccess que está oculto y podría no ser visible.

Crear una copia de la base de datos 

Necesitas exportar tu base de datos.

Para Magento 2.x

Si no estás seguro de cuál es el nombre de la base de datos, puedes encontrarlo en el archivo env.php. Para exportarla, sigue las instrucciones aquí. Una vez hayas exportado la base de datos, crea una nueva base de datos e importa su contenido en ella.

Para Magento 1.x

Si no estás seguro de cuál es el nombre de la base de datos, puedes encontrarlo en el archivo local.xml. Para exportarla, sigue las instrucciones aquí. Una vez hayas exportado la base de datos, crea una nueva base de datos e importa su contenido en ella.

Reconfigurar Magento como corresponde

El siguiente paso es alterar el archivo de configuración para que coincida con los nuevos ajustes. Solo necesitas cambiar aquí los detalles de la base de datos en la nueva ubicación.

Para Magento 2.x

Estos están almacenados en el archivo app/etc/env.php. Las líneas que tienes que alterar son:

'host' => 'yourhost',
'dbname' => 'your_db',
'username' => 'your_user',
'password' => 'yourpassword',

Para Magento 1.x

Estos están almacenados en el archivo app/etc/local.xml. Las líneas que tienes que alterar son:

<host><![CDATA[yourhost]]></host>
<username><![CDATA[your_user]]></username>
<password><![CDATA[yourpassword]]></password>
<dbname><![CDATA[your_db]]></dbname>

donde:

  • yourhost debería ser el nombre del host de la base de datos, normalmente – localhost;
  • your_user es un usuario con privilegios totales a la base de datos;
  • yourpassword es la contraseña para el usuario de la base de datos;
  • your_db es el nombre completo de la base de datos que vas a usar con el nuevo Magento.

El siguiente paso es actualizar la URL de la nueva aplicación Magento como se muestra en este artículo aquí. Eso es todo. Tu Magento debería ahora estar funcionando correctamente en la nueva ubicación.

Comparte este artículo